Visitor class

Base visitor class for the style sheet AST.

Implemented types
Implementers

Constructors

Visitor()

Properties

hashCode int
The hash code for this object.
no setterin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ited

Methods

no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toString() String
A string representation of this object.
inherited
visitAngleTerm(AngleTerm node) → dynamic
override
visitAttributeSelector(AttributeSelector node) → dynamic
override
visitBinaryExpression(BinaryExpression node) → dynamic
override
visitBorderExpression(BorderExpression node) → dynamic
override
visitBoxExpression(BoxExpression node) → dynamic
override
visitCalcTerm(CalcTerm node) → dynamic
override
visitCharsetDirective(CharsetDirective node) → dynamic
override
visitChTerm(ChTerm node) → dynamic
override
visitClassSelector(ClassSelector node) → dynamic
override
visitCommentDefinition(CommentDefinition node) → dynamic
override
visitContentDirective(ContentDirective node) → dynamic
override
visitCssComment(CssComment node) → dynamic
override
visitDartStyleExpression(DartStyleExpression node) → dynamic
override
visitDeclaration(Declaration node) → dynamic
override
visitDeclarationGroup(DeclarationGroup node) → dynamic
override
visitDirective(Directive node) → dynamic
override
visitDocumentDirective(DocumentDirective node) → dynamic
override
visitElementSelector(ElementSelector node) → dynamic
override
visitEmTerm(EmTerm node) → dynamic
override
visitExpressions(Expressions node) → dynamic
override
visitExtendDeclaration(ExtendDeclaration node) → dynamic
override
visitExTerm(ExTerm node) → dynamic
override
visitFontExpression(FontExpression node) → dynamic
override
visitFontFaceDirective(FontFaceDirective node) → dynamic
override
visitFractionTerm(FractionTerm node) → dynamic
override
visitFreqTerm(FreqTerm node) → dynamic
override
visitFunctionTerm(FunctionTerm node) → dynamic
override
visitGroupTerm(GroupTerm node) → dynamic
override
visitHeightExpression(HeightExpression node) → dynamic
override
visitHexColorTerm(HexColorTerm node) → dynamic
override
visitHostDirective(HostDirective node) → dynamic
override
visitIdentifier(Identifier node) → dynamic
override
visitIdSelector(IdSelector node) → dynamic
override
visitIE8Term(IE8Term node) → dynamic
override
visitImportDirective(ImportDirective node) → dynamic
override
visitIncludeDirective(IncludeDirective node) → dynamic
override
visitIncludeMixinAtDeclaration(IncludeMixinAtDeclaration node) → dynamic
override
visitItemTerm(ItemTerm node) → dynamic
override
visitKeyFrameBlock(KeyFrameBlock node) → dynamic
override
visitKeyFrameDirective(KeyFrameDirective node) → dynamic
override
visitLengthTerm(LengthTerm node) → dynamic
override
visitLiteralTerm(LiteralTerm node) → dynamic
override
visitMarginExpression(MarginExpression node) → dynamic
override
visitMarginGroup(MarginGroup node) → dynamic
override
visitMediaDirective(MediaDirective node) → dynamic
override
visitMediaExpression(MediaExpression node) → dynamic
override
visitMediaQuery(MediaQuery node) → dynamic
override
visitMixinDeclarationDirective(MixinDeclarationDirective node) → dynamic
override
visitMixinDefinition(MixinDefinition node) → dynamic
override
visitMixinRulesetDirective(MixinRulesetDirective node) → dynamic
override
visitNamespaceDirective(NamespaceDirective node) → dynamic
override
visitNamespaceSelector(NamespaceSelector node) → dynamic
override
visitNegation(Negation node) → dynamic
override
visitNegationSelector(NegationSelector node) → dynamic
override
visitNoOp(NoOp node) → dynamic
override
visitNumberTerm(NumberTerm node) → dynamic
override
visitOperatorComma(OperatorComma node) → dynamic
override
visitOperatorMinus(OperatorMinus node) → dynamic
override
visitOperatorPlus(OperatorPlus node) → dynamic
override
visitOperatorSlash(OperatorSlash node) → dynamic
override
visitPaddingExpression(PaddingExpression node) → dynamic
override
visitPageDirective(PageDirective node) → dynamic
override
visitPercentageTerm(PercentageTerm node) → dynamic
override
visitPseudoClassFunctionSelector(PseudoClassFunctionSelector node) → dynamic
override
visitPseudoClassSelector(PseudoClassSelector node) → dynamic
override
visitPseudoElementFunctionSelector(PseudoElementFunctionSelector node) → dynamic
override
visitPseudoElementSelector(PseudoElementSelector node) → dynamic
override
visitRemTerm(RemTerm node) → dynamic
override
visitResolutionTerm(ResolutionTerm node) → dynamic
override
visitRuleSet(RuleSet node) → dynamic
override
visitSelector(Selector node) → dynamic
override
visitSelectorExpression(SelectorExpression node) → dynamic
override
visitSelectorGroup(SelectorGroup node) → dynamic
override
visitSimpleSelector(SimpleSelector node) → dynamic
override
visitSimpleSelectorSequence(SimpleSelectorSequence node) → dynamic
override
visitStyleSheet(StyleSheet ss) → dynamic
override
visitStyletDirective(StyletDirective node) → dynamic
override
visitSupportsConditionInParens(SupportsConditionInParens node) → dynamic
override
visitSupportsConjunction(SupportsConjunction node) → dynamic
override
visitSupportsDirective(SupportsDirective node) → dynamic
override
visitSupportsDisjunction(SupportsDisjunction node) → dynamic
override
visitSupportsNegation(SupportsNegation node) → dynamic
override
visitThisOperator(ThisOperator node) → dynamic
override
visitTimeTerm(TimeTerm node) → dynamic
override
visitTopLevelProduction(TopLevelProduction node) → dynamic
override
visitTree(StyleSheet tree) → dynamic
visitUnaryExpression(UnaryExpression node) → dynamic
override
visitUnicodeRangeTerm(UnicodeRangeTerm node) → dynamic
override
visitUnitTerm(UnitTerm node) → dynamic
override
visitUriTerm(UriTerm node) → dynamic
override
visitVarDefinition(VarDefinition node) → dynamic
override
visitVarDefinitionDirective(VarDefinitionDirective node) → dynamic
override
visitVarUsage(VarUsage node) → dynamic
override
visitViewportDirective(ViewportDirective node) → dynamic
override
visitViewportTerm(ViewportTerm node) → dynamic
override
visitWidthExpression(WidthExpression node) → dynamic
override
visitWildcard(Wildcard node) → dynamic
override

Operators

operator ==(Object other) bool
The equality operator.
inherited